Quick answer

Nainwari is a village in Tikamgarh Tehsil of Tikamgarh district in Madhya Pradesh. Its Census location code is 457300.

About Nainwari village record

Nainwari is listed under Tikamgarh Tehsil in Tikamgarh district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 2,123, 531 households, area 860.20 hectares.
